Local backup of iDisk (tip)

I just found I could make a scheduled back up of the contents of my iDisk onto a sparse disk image on my local hard drive, using SuperDuper.

That way, I could keep daily, weekly or monthly copies of the documents there, free from the danger that the remote copy gets deleted or otherwise inaccessible. Cool!

I have iDisk sync set to 'on', update automatically.
